Output 58985a2bb765e3401d66df9a13256b6ced6739f83219d4aa8ab2fe91bd3e137e:58

value
850000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 00758fc966af8e0a17762806aae05389e96034dd531c956782c3f145e68f1485
address
tb1pqp6cljtx478q59mk9qr24czn385kqdxa2vwf2euzc0c5te50zjzs979rjq
transaction
58985a2bb765e3401d66df9a13256b6ced6739f83219d4aa8ab2fe91bd3e137e
confirmations
15736
spent
true